Scrapy是一个用于爬取网站数据的Python框架,它可以帮助开发者快速、高效地从网页中提取所需的数据。当在本地站点上使用Scrapy时,如果找不到任何东西,可能是以下几个原因导致的:
- 网站结构问题:Scrapy依赖于网页的HTML结构来提取数据,如果网站的HTML结构发生了变化,可能会导致Scrapy无法正确提取数据。可以通过检查网站的HTML源代码,确认网站结构是否发生了变化。
- 网站访问限制:有些网站会设置反爬虫机制,限制爬虫程序的访问。这些限制可能包括IP封禁、验证码、登录等。如果你的本地站点设置了这些限制,Scrapy可能无法正常访问网站。可以尝试使用代理IP、处理验证码或模拟登录等方法来解决这个问题。
- 爬虫配置问题:Scrapy的爬虫需要正确配置才能正常工作。可能是你的爬虫配置有误,导致无法找到任何东西。可以检查爬虫的代码,确认是否正确设置了起始URL、提取规则等。
- 网络连接问题:如果你的本地站点无法正常连接到互联网,Scrapy将无法访问任何网站。可以检查网络连接是否正常,尝试访问其他网站确认网络是否正常工作。
总结起来,Scrapy在本地站点上找不到任何东西可能是由于网站结构问题、网站访问限制、爬虫配置问题或网络连接问题导致的。需要仔细检查以上几个方面,逐一排查并解决问题。